Output dc59b87e2a10570a79f4238f88148fda75ddfce861e0ae563c5a0be85882634f:1

value
124680757
script pubkey
OP_0 OP_PUSHBYTES_20 6b0b51ed544cfbbc59bb002c3c68d93c01c1f1c4
address
bc1qdv94rm25fnamckdmqqkrc6xe8squruwytf9z7t
transaction
dc59b87e2a10570a79f4238f88148fda75ddfce861e0ae563c5a0be85882634f
spent
true